Reaction
chymotrypsin-like protease, cleaves peptide bonds containing phenylalanine and proline =
Synonyms
chymotrypsin-like protease, chymotrypsin-like proteinase, CTLP, dentilisin, PrtP, PrtP protease, S08.024, Td chymotrypsin-like protease, Td-CTLP

diagnostics
Treponema denticola chymotrypsin-like protease is associated with human papillomavirus-negative oropharyngeal squamous cell carcinoma
medicine
Treponema denticola exerts a pathogenic effect on periodontal tissue via local dysregulation of inflammatory cytokines by dentilisin

additional information
-
contributes to tissue invasion and lysis of host cells, important in migration of the organism through basement membrane, cytopathic effects on epithelial cells, able to trigger release of polymorphonuclear leukocyte granules and activates latent matrix metalloproteinases
